Perquimans Has No Three-Day Feed
The official Albemarle District Jail homepage provides no roster archive, recent-release tab, or rolling 72-hour filter. The same negative-evidence URL applies to both one-day and three-day questions because there is no separate release-list page. The jail links “Inmate Lookup” directly to VINELink site 34003, where a visitor searches one person. Perquimans Sheriff does not publish a parallel regional-jail release feed.

Check Three Days of Perquimans Releases
A three-day review should use fixed start and end dates. “Last 72 hours” can otherwise shift while the request is being handled. Albemarle holds the adult local custody record even when the Perquimans Sheriff made the arrest.
- Write down the three calendar dates and the time zone used for the request.
- Search the named person through the Albemarle VINELink link and confirm the reporting custodian.
- Call Albemarle at (252) 335-4844 for the person’s release or transfer status.
- Ask whether an existing release log can be produced for the fixed date range.
- Request admission and release time, disposition, destination, and arresting agency as maintained.
- Compare local results with the Perquimans court case and any receiving agency.
Use the Perquimans 24-Hour Releases page when the question is limited to the latest day. Neither window has an official public feed, so the difference is the requested period, not a different database.
Fields for a Perquimans 72-Hour Log
The jail publishes no online columns, cadence, photo field, or retention rule for a three-day list. The table identifies useful fields in an existing release entry or log. Ask the custodian to provide the wording it maintains, especially for the disposition and destination.
| Requested field | Why it matters over three days |
|---|---|
| Name and booking identifier | Separates people with similar names and connects the exit to one admission |
| Admission date and time | Distinguishes an older stay from a new booking |
| Release date and time | Places the event within the fixed three-day period |
| Arresting agency | Shows whether Perquimans was tied to the confinement event |
| Release disposition | Separates bond, court order, time served, commitment, and transfer |
| Destination | Identifies continued custody when the person did not enter the community |
| Charge or bond data | Connects the jail record to the correct court case as maintained |
Perquimans Weekend Release Review
A three-day span is useful because it can cross Friday through Sunday or include an observed holiday. That does not mean Albemarle follows a published weekend-release schedule. The research found no official release hours, early-release practice, holiday rule, exit location, or update cadence. Do not predict a Friday release or assume an event posts on the next business day.
Check the court Register of Actions for orders entered during the period and ask the jail for the operational date and time. A court order may explain authority for release but does not itself prove when staff completed discharge. When an order and custody status seem to conflict, check other charges and holds before treating the difference as an error.
Request the Albemarle Three-Day Record
Albemarle publishes no dedicated records form, fixed copy charge, or guaranteed response period. Supply the exact dates, identify Perquimans as the arresting or case county, and ask only for an existing release log or release entries. G.S. 132-6.2 allows access to existing public records in an available form but does not force an agency to create a new list or calculate a rolling window that it does not maintain.
Ask for electronic delivery and a cost estimate before work begins. North Carolina law permits actual reproduction costs and may allow a reasonable special-service charge for extraordinary resource use. If a field is withheld, request the statutory basis. For one person, include full name, date of birth if known, approximate admission, and the expected release range to help staff distinguish the event.

Verify Perquimans Status After Exit
Leaving Albemarle can mean community release or a transfer. A jail-to-NC DAC commitment, pickup by another county, federal handoff, or immigration detainer continues custody elsewhere. Use the release disposition and destination to choose the next database.
| Record | What it can prove | What it cannot prove alone |
|---|---|---|
| Albemarle release entry | Local exit time and recorded disposition | Status after an agency handoff |
| VINELink | Reporting custodian status and alerts | A complete historical three-day list |
| eCourts Register of Actions | Case event and legal disposition | Physical release time |
| NC DAC OPI | State prison and supervision status | Jail-only confinement |
| BOP or ICE locator | Status in the named federal system | Freedom from every custodian |
State Releases Are Not Jail Releases
The NC DAC monthly released-offender search can be filtered by release county and month. It is useful for people leaving state prison, but it is not a substitute for an Albemarle 72-hour list. A result that says Perquimans uses DAC’s release-county field. It does not establish release from Albemarle, county of conviction, or residence. Open the person’s OPI detail and read overall inmate and supervision status.
VINE Alerts During a Three-Day Window
NC SAVAN/VINELink covers North Carolina jails and Adult Correction prison, probation, and parole feeds. A user may search a matched person and register for available phone, email, text, or app alerts. Alerts can help during a weekend, but the service is still person-specific. It does not create a list of all Perquimans releases and does not cover BOP, ICE, juvenile detention, unbooked magistrate bond-outs, or local police holding.
After an alert, call Albemarle for the exact date, time, disposition, and destination. A transfer can require finding the new custodian and registering again. Never treat a stopped alert or absent result as enough proof of community release.
Resolve Conflicting Perquimans Dates
A booking date, court-order date, jail release time, state admission, projected release date, actual prison release date, supervision start, and database-update time can all differ without contradiction. Record the precise label and source for each date. Use the official NC DAC OPI search for state records. If OPI shows an old Actual Release Date but the overall inmate header is active, the old sentence block is historical. If OPI shows actual release plus active supervision, incarceration ended but supervision did not.
The strongest statement stays narrow: identify the custodian, the event label, the date, and any destination. That method is more reliable than a broad claim based only on the person being absent from a live screen.
Match Perquimans Records Across Three Days
A three-day result set raises the risk of confusing people with the same or similar name. Track the spelling used, date of birth if lawfully available, booking or offender number, arresting agency, custodian, case number, and exact release timestamp. The eCourts overview and Portal guidance explain the court search and Register of Actions; the live public Portal performs the actual case lookup. Identifiers from these systems are not interchangeable. A jail booking number should not be treated as an NC DAC offender number, BOP number, A-number, or court file number.
When records disagree, first ask whether the fields answer different questions. A judgment date, jail exit time, state admission date, supervision start, and database update can fall on separate days. Preserve a dated observation, identify its source, and ask the office that created the field what it represents. A reliable statement should name the agency and event, such as an Albemarle transfer followed by an OPI admission, rather than claiming a person was simply released.
Keep Perquimans Custody Systems Separate
Perquimans Juvenile Detention Center is a state-operated secure juvenile facility in Hertford, not an adult jail. Juvenile placement and release information uses restricted family, attorney, facility, and juvenile-court channels. Adult VINELink, OPI, BOP, and registry searches must not be used to reconstruct a child’s custody history.
No adult NC DAC prison, BOP institution, ICE detention center, or USMS-operated jail was verified within Perquimans County. Even so, a person connected to a Perquimans case may be held by one of those systems elsewhere. A transfer recorded during the three-day window should be followed through the named receiving system. BOP’s Released or Not in BOP Custody language covers BOP only. ICE locator absence may reflect exact-input problems or its limited recent-release window. Neither should be collapsed into proof of unrestricted community release.
The Perquimans Sheriff remains useful for its own arrest and investigative records, but Albemarle is the adult confinement custodian. Direct each request to the office that created the event.
